Using HP MaxiLife to Diagnose Problems
Using HP MaxiLife to Diagnose Problems
Your HP LCD can help you to diagnose problems with your PC
Workstation, even when you are unable to get your system and monitor
working properly.
Pre-Boot Checks
When you press your PC Workstation’s on/off button, HP MaxiLife will
check your system before it initiates the start-up sequence. You will see
one of the following screens on the LCD as these checks progress:
